Barbara Hearn Baxter Gordon
A sweet soul has found a place to rest. Barbara Hearn Baxter Gordon, age 73, of Marion, VA, died peacefully on March 11, 2017, at Holston Valley Medical Center in Kingsport, TN, from complications due to vascular disease. She was born on May 28, 1943 in Pulaski County, VA to Naomi Rose Hackler of Elk Creek, VA and James Frank Hearn, of Wytheville, VA. Barbara was a 1961 graduate of Rural Retreat High School and attended the nursing program at Johnston Memorial Hospital. She served others as a registered nurse for over thirty years at Southwest Virginia Mental Health Institute, and was fascinated by the inner workings of the human mind.
She loved a good nap, eating at Cracker Barrel, doing word search puzzles, telling good stories, and spending time with her family and friends. Never was there a gentler and more gracious soul than Barbara and being a caregiver to anyone in need was her truest source of happiness. She was our best friend and our biggest encourager, and there is a huge hole in our hearts and in our lives that she so lovingly filled while she was here with us.
